Big_Cake

晓雨杂记

也许我们会分别,但我们将永远不会忘记彼此
bilibili
github
twitter
zhihu
telegram
tg_channel

Recording a Windows reinstallation

I can't take it anymore! I want to switch to Linux! I have nothing in common with 0x800707e7!

Switching to Linux is impossible. I will never switch to Linux in this lifetime.

Reason#

Recently, the latest Canary preview version of Windows has been failing to update, and there is very little available space left on the C drive. I tried my best to clean up and managed to free up 80 GB of space. At the same time, the system notifications from QQNT were not working on my computer for some reason.

Finally, I decided to bite the bullet, backup necessary data, and reinstall Windows, while also returning to the Dev channel.

Process#

Fortunately, I had my own external hard drive at hand, so I plugged it into the computer and started searching everywhere on the C drive. I saved the installation packages of software installed on the C drive and other necessary software to the hard drive.

After that, I started extracting important things from the AppData directory and also saved them to the hard drive. Oh, I shouldn't forget about the registry and settings for launchers like BakaXL and PCL2.

After completing all of this, I unplugged the hard drive and started downloading the latest Dev version 23493 image.

I checked and found that Microsoft had not updated the Dev channel image on their official website, so I had to resort to uupdump to create an image myself.

System: Windows 11; Architecture: x64; Version: Dev 23493; SKU: Home Chinese Edition...

As for why I chose the Home edition, it's because the laptops come pre-installed with the Home edition of Windows, so I chose the Home edition.

After downloading the tool package, I started creating the image:

image

While it was creating the image, I went out to get a bucket of water. When I came back, I saw that the image was already done. So I checked the directory, mounted the image, and started the installation!

To my surprise, the reinstallation process was very fast, but the update process took almost an hour and it failed...

After restarting and waiting for about five to six minutes, I entered the OOBE phase. It looked laggy because there were no drivers.

After completing OOBE, I logged in to my Microsoft account and saw the familiar desktop. After waiting for a while, I let Windows install the drivers, and then it was time for the joyful process of reinstalling software and personalization!

imageThere are also limited edition mouse pointers! The desktop and terminal backgrounds are drawn by Pixiv's CoCoLo.

Strangely, LyricEase and many UWP apps on this version have noticeable animation lag. I don't know why.

At the same time, the new version of File Explorer welcomed me with open arms:

imageProudly powered by Windows UI 3

Pitfall#

However, when reinstalling software and installing new games, I encountered a pitfall: file permission issues on the D drive, and it was quite severe.

Specifically, there were some directories that inexplicably required administrator permissions to access after reinstalling the system, and even Minecraft couldn't write files to certain directories.

For these directories, my solution was to modify the owner and permissions in the "Properties" window of Windows. If that didn't work, I would simply restart into Ubuntu and forget about that directory.

Also, MacType couldn't render the Start menu and some UWP apps anymore, and Edge Beta couldn't render web pages either. However, Chrome Canary next door worked fine, and I could even use MacType to render web pages in Chrome without changing any flags.


Oh, by the way, the blog now uses Source Han Sans as the web font, thanks to our old friend Google Fonts. The reason behind this is that I can't stand not having Microsoft YaHei without MacType..

Loading...
Ownership of this post data is guaranteed by blockchain and smart contracts to the creator alone.